Berbere Spiced Chickpea Bowl Recipe

  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 2 bowls 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

This Berbere Spiced Chickpea Bowl is a flavorful and wholesome dish inspired by Ethiopian cuisine. It features spiced chickpeas served over quinoa or rice with fresh vegetables and a creamy finish.


Ingredients

Scale

Spiced Chickpeas:

  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 small red onion, sliced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 (15 oz) can chickpeas, drained and rinsed
  • 1 tablespoon berbere spice blend
  • 1 tablespoon tomato paste
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 cup vegetable broth or water

Assembly:

  • 1 cup cooked quinoa or rice
  • 1/2 cup chopped cucumber
  • 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1/4 avocado, sliced
  • 2 tablespoons plain yogurt or tahini sauce
  • Fresh cilantro or parsley for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are Spiced Chickpeas: Heat olive oil in a skillet, sauté onion, add garlic, chickpeas, berbere spice, tomato paste, salt, pepper, and broth. Simmer until thickened.
  2. Assemble Bowl: Layer quinoa or rice, top with spiced chickpeas, cucumber, tomatoes, avocado, and a dollop of yogurt or tahini sauce. Garnish with herbs.

Notes

  • For a vegan version, use tahini sauce instead of yogurt.
  • Adjust berbere spice to taste for varying spice levels.
